East Stephens Settling

East Stephens Settling is an earth dam located in St. Louis County, Minnesota, built in 1964. It carries a Low hazard potential classification and has a fair condition assessment.

About East Stephens Settling

The primary purpose of East Stephens Settling is tailings. Tailings dams contain waste material from mining operations — typically a slurry of finely ground rock left over after valuable minerals have been extracted. These structures require ongoing monitoring because tailings can contain heavy metals and other contaminants. The dam is owned by Mesabi Nugget (private). It impounds the Second Creek near Local Residents.

The dam stands 15 feet tall and stretches 3,000 feet across, creates a reservoir covering 260 acres, and has a maximum storage capacity of 310 acre-feet. Completed in 1964, the structure is well into its service life at over 50 years old.

This dam has a low hazard potential classification, meaning that failure would cause minimal damage, limited primarily to the dam owner's property, with no expected loss of life. Its condition is rated fair — the dam has minor deficiencies that are being addressed or do not pose an immediate safety threat. The most recent inspection on record was 09/17/2014.
